    from my teaching upon these points. It is a truism to remark that the history of the
    world is based on the emergence of ideas, their acceptance, their transformation into
    ideals, and their eventual superseding by the next imposition of ideas. It is in this
    realm of [8] ideas that humanity is not a free agent. This is an important point to
    note. Once an idea becomes an ideal, humanity can freely reject or accept it, but ideas
    come from a higher source and are imposed upon the racial mind, whether men want
    them or not. Upon the use made of these ideas (which are in the nature of divine
    emanations, embodying the divine plan for planetary progress) will depend the rapidity of
    humanity's progress or its retardation for lack of understanding. Humanity is
    today more sensitive to ideas than ever before, and hence the many warring ideologies and
    hence the fact that - in defense of their plans - even the most recalcitrant of the
    nations has to discover some idealistic excuse to put before the other nations when
    occupied with any infringement of recognized law. This is a fact of great significance to
    the Hierarchy for it indicates a point reached. The major ideas in the world today fall
    into five categories which it would be well for you to bear in mind: 
      The ancient and inherited ideas which have controlled the racial life for centuries -
        aggression for the sake of possession and the authority of a man or a group or a church
        which represents the State. For purposes of policy such powers may work behind the scenes
        but their tenets and motives are easily recognizable - selfish ambition and a violently
        imposed authority.
